Water, the Body’s Best Friend

Our bodies are composed of about 60% water, and nearly every system and function within us relies on it. From digestion and circulation to temperature regulation and waste elimination, water is involved in just about everything. Here’s a closer look at how staying properly hydrated can benefit your health and fitness journey:

Maintaining Proper Body Function

Water is vital for maintaining proper body function. It helps transport nutrients and oxygen to cells, remove waste products, and regulate body temperature. When you’re adequately hydrated, your body can perform at its best, allowing you to push through those tough workouts and recover effectively.

Weight Management

If you’re looking to shed some pounds or maintain a healthy weight, water can be your ally. Often, we mistake thirst for hunger, leading to unnecessary snacking. Staying hydrated can help curb those hunger pangs and make it easier to stick to your dietary goals.

Enhanced Physical Performance

Dehydration can lead to fatigue, muscle cramps, and reduced endurance during exercise. By staying well-hydrated, you can perform better and longer, making your workouts more effective. Remember, even a small drop in hydration levels can impact your performance.

Signs of Dehydration

Now that we’ve highlighted the benefits of proper hydration, let’s discuss some common signs of dehydration that you should watch out for:

Thirst

Thirst is your body’s way of signalling that it needs water. If you’re feeling thirsty, don’t ignore it; take a sip of water to stay ahead of dehydration.

Dark Urine

Your urine colour can be a clear indicator of your hydration status. Dark yellow or amber-coloured urine usually suggests dehydration. Aim for pale yellow urine as a sign that you’re well-hydrated.

Dry Mouth and Skin

Dry mouth and dry, flaky skin can also be signs of dehydration. Keeping your skin and mouth moist is essential for overall health and comfort.

Fatigue and Weakness

Feeling unusually tired or weak might be a result of dehydration. Proper hydration can help boost your energy levels and keep you alert throughout the day.

How Much Water Do You Need?

The ideal amount of water to drink every day can vary from person to person depending on factors such as sex, age, climate, and activity level. However, a general guideline is to aim for about 8-10 cups (64-80 ounces) of water per day. This includes water from beverages and foods.

Listen to Your Body

While these recommendations are useful, it’s crucial to listen to your body. Thirst is a reliable indicator of when you need to drink more water. Additionally, if you’re engaged in intense physical activity or exposed to hot weather, you’ll need to increase your fluid intake to compensate for the extra loss through sweat.

Staying Hydrated Throughout the Day

Now that you understand the importance of proper hydration and how to recognise signs of dehydration, let’s explore some practical tips to help you stay adequately hydrated throughout the day:

Start Your Day with a Glass of Water

After a long night’s sleep, your body needs hydration to kick-start your metabolism and prepare you for the day ahead. Drinking a glass of water in the morning can help you get on the right track.

Carry a Reusable Water Bottle

Having a reusable water bottle with you makes it easy to sip water throughout the day. It’s a convenient reminder to stay hydrated.

Set Hydration Goals

Set achievable daily goals for water intake. For example, you can aim to finish a certain number of bottles or glasses of water by specific times during the day.

Infuse Your Water

If plain water doesn’t excite you, add some flavour by infusing it with slices of citrus fruits, cucumber, or berries. It can make staying hydrated more enjoyable.

Create a Routine

Incorporate drinking water into your daily routine. For instance, have a glass of water before each meal or snack. This not only helps with hydration but can also aid in portion control.
